hi gang,

i wanted to post my experience. i ordered a 17 inch via adc on 3/31. i had a ship date of 3-5 weeks.

i have a 933 tower and 500 cube. the 17 inch was going to replace my 15 inch 667 ti.

i just added the cube for home and i love everything about it.

i'm a photographer and i used the 15 inch in the field to download my digital images . however, i called adc and cancelled my order.

after working on some pentiums (photoshop and dv editing) the macs are definitely slower. my studio mate has a 1.25 dual and it is a little faster but the speed still can't compare to some of the pentium workstations i have used.

so instead of getting a laptop that's similar in performance to my other macs, i will wait for something faster hopefully by the end of the year. whether it's a new g5 or dual 2 gig g4 or whatever.

i don't care what it is i just need more speed. i hope it's soon because i love macs.

the 17 inch felt faster then my 933 tower which is maxed out.

i render huge video files and it's a killer on the macs.

just wanted to share...

If a 'G5' was to be introduced, it would be a minimum of a year before it was available in laptop form.

I think the next rev of 17" (late fall/winter) would see a 1.25Ghz, upgraded video board, and the 80GB HD. Dual in a laptop just doesn't make sense. The heat would be insane, along with the incredibly short battery life.

I'm a unix sysadmin so my needs are different, but I use PC's for desktops and a Mac for my mobile solution.

What I do is offload my processor intensive (and platform independent) tasks to two Athlon systems running linux in the closet. They handle divx encoding, x886 software compliling, and other stuff. I can access them via X windows or MS terminal server client to get a login screen on each. I use vmware on one to run windows advanced server as a virtual host on one system.

My P4 is really nothing more than a game box.
